FEEDING PROBLEMS

Rough wire feeding or wire will not feed but drive rolls are turning.

1.The gun cable may be kinked or twisted.

2.The wire may be jammed in the gun cable, or gun cable may be dirty.

3.Check drive roll tension and position of grooves.

4.Check for worn or loose drive rolls.

5.The electrode may be rusty or dirty.

6.Check for damaged or incorrect contact tip.

7.Check wire spindle for ease of rotation and adjust break ten- sion knob if necessary.

8.Check that the gun is pushed all the way into gun mount and properly seated.

If all recommended possible areas of misadjustment have been checked and the problem persists,

Contact your local Lincoln Authorized Field Service Facility.
